WoW. I just logged on and am blushing over the many kind sentiments that have been expressed towards me here. I am truly grateful for all of the thoughts and support.
I have been averaging about twelve hour work days for the last several months. We are slated to lose 180 million dollars for mental health and substance abuse disorders in Michigan. This will cause cost shifting as the working poor will end up in emergency rooms, increased crime, local incarcerations, etc. which will add to local costs.
I am working on revamping our website which is Harbor Hall Treatment Center Petoskey Michigan, I have been working to develop more self pay referrals, attending many conferences where we can set up a booth to display our services, meeting with lawmakers to keep our funding viable, working with marketing people to brand our services and get the word out, plus being involved in many volunteer activities. I am involved in Rotary, Anglefood Ministries, Human Services Coordinating Body for Charlevoix and Emmet County, Opiate Replacement task Force, two grass root organizations to quell underage tobacco, drug and alcohol use, a transportation committee to get mass transit services in our area, and a suicide prevention work group. I am also involved in ALSAO which is a provider alliance whose dues support a lobbyist to represent our concerns in Lansing. I also do the books for my wife's gift store, garden and ride a bicycle.
I think I am nuts.![]()
![]()
Something had to give as I find myself going home most nights and dying in an easy chair. I only have a hair over 1,000 miles on my bicycle this season as the weather has been cold and nasty for the summer.
I am humbled by the support from everyone here and, please know that all of you are in my thoughts and prayers. I am very thankful to God for my life back as, it has been almost three years post-op and, I would not be accomplishing all of the things I do, with my spine being the way it was, before four artificial discs were put in at Stenum Hospital in November 2006.
I hope to have everything resolved with the State prior to the start of the new fiscal year which comes up October 1st. I will be coming back to the group then and am hopeful that our program will be still in practice.

Just a quick update all. We are in the final throes of having a budget or a shut-down in the State of Michigan. If we do not have a budget by October 1st we may have a continuation budget that is still not effective. The latest budget possibility is that the Democrats may go along with the Senate Republican plan just to avoid a shut-down which would be a re-enactment of what happened two years ago. The cuts in the Senate proposal are another 1.2 billion dollars out of our State budget with no revenue enhancements at all to shore up the bleeding in our state. For a unbiased opinion about the true story about what is going on in Michigan, read Michigan Tax Truth. I say this because, the failed policies of our state may be being entertained by some of the states that some of you live in and, you need to see first hand what our failed policies are doing to a state that led the country in making the middle class. The middle class were made by high paying manufacturing jobs that are now being sent overseas and providing wealth to a select few in our country rather than distributing the wealth more evenly. If the cost of labor is driven downward, we place our state in a position where, only shareholders wealth continues to climb while the middle class is further eroded to the ranks of the poor. Our term limited legislators are continuing to avoid the true picture in our state where our policies have provided tax cuts for over a decade and this still has not brought our state in to any prosperity. The beer tax has not been touched since 1966 in which case the tax was lowered. Our state is being driven by powerful lobbying and special interest groups, which is the same in the country, where the lies and misinformation continue to go out daily on health care reform.
